PlayStation Network restoration runs into hiccupsSo Sony has already started to restore its PlayStation Network (PSN) service to the masses, but that doesn’t mean there are no more hiccups involved. Some users have in fact started to complain over Twitter that it was active only for a short while before it became unavailable yet again – something that PSN users have gotten used over the past 3 weeks. Tom Cranfield tweeted that “Playstation Network was back up for about 10 minutes before going down again for maintenance. Nice work Sony!”

As for Lee Fraser of Manchester, England, he tweeted that “Playstation Network is Back down looks like the servers have crashed.” This has led Sony’s PlayStationEU Twitter feed to ask users to be patient. That might just be pushing it considering they have been patient for nearly a month already.

Sony themselves announced that it is a planned outage of its network services, as they are “expereiencing [sic] a heavy load of password resets and will be turning off the services for 30 minutes to clear the queue.”
